Is Reformer Pilates safe for everyone?
While Reformer Pilates is generally safe, it's important to consult with your doctor before starting any new workout regimen, especially if you have any underlying health conditions, injuries or are pregnant. Please make sure to share with the instructor of these conditions before your session starts.

What are the benefits of Reformer Pilates?
Reformer Pilates offers numerous benefits, including:

  • Improved strength and flexibility: The reformer's resistance system helps build muscle and increase flexibility.

  • Enhanced core strength: Many exercises target the core muscles, leading to better posture and stability.

  • Increased body awareness: Reformer Pilates helps you connect with your body and understand its movements.

  • Stress reduction: The mindful nature of Pilates can help alleviate stress and promote relaxation.

  • Injury prevention: The controlled movements and focus on proper alignment can help prevent injuries.
